
Mahlin
Mahlin is a name of uncertain origin but commonly associated with the idea of a 'hero' or 'gift', embodying positive connotations of strength and generosity. It is primarily used in English-speaking countries, where it has gained popularity in recent years as a unique name for girls. While traditionally feminine, Mahlin can also be considered unisex.
The name evokes feelings of strength and nobility, making it an appealing choice for parents looking for something distinctive yet meaningful. It is easy to pronounce and write, with a melodic quality that adds to its charm.
Although Mahlin may not feature prominently in historical texts or popular culture, it reflects modern naming trends towards individuality.
